首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 140 毫秒
1.
工作流管理系统是实现各种信息管理系统工作过程自动化的核心模块。本文提出一种工作流元模型和基于该元模型进行工作流建模的方法,并实现一个构件化的工作流管理系统。该系统支持基于元模型的工作流建模,提供工作流运行的环境,并可以构件的方式集成到外部系统中。  相似文献   

2.
根据工作流管理联盟(WFMC)制定的过程定义元模型和基于XML的过程定义语言(XPDL)规范,论文设计了一个独立通用的基于活动网络图工作流过程模型,它可以输出一个标准通用的过程定义,该过程定义能被不同的工作流运行系统解释与执行。  相似文献   

3.
随着工作流的广泛应用,人们对工作流系统的灵活性提出了新的要求。作为工作流系统的核心,工作流的过程元模型很大程度上决定了工作流系统的能力。结合互联网工程任务组(Internet Engineering Task Force,IETF)提出的策略的概念和策略部署模型,提出一种基于策略的工作流管理系统,并结合工作流系统的特点,提出了描述工作流策略语言,使用基于策略扩展的Petri网建立工作流过程模型的方法。基于该元模型的定义的工作流具有较好的灵活性,并对工作流的运行期实例的动态修改提供支持。  相似文献   

4.
魏歌 《计算机工程与设计》2011,32(5):1730-1733,1737
把另一个工作流语言系统纳入到模型驱动架构中来,是该系统开发由理论逐步走向应用的途径,为了实现这个构思,提供了基于的工作流模式的建模方法。通过对于工作流元建模开发架构进行的认知与分解,确定了另一个工作流语言系统在该架构中最适合的阶段和层次。在此基础上,建立了基于工作流模式的元建模框架,利用图的语言,设计了基于结构及特点分析的模型转换的框架。该方法有利于提高软件开发的效率并具有交互性和可复用性。  相似文献   

5.
为了使工作流系统在执行过程中支持动态可变性,分析了工作流过程定义阶段及流程执行阶段的动态性特征,提出了基于过程模型的动态工作流,并在动态工作流元模型中定义相应的操作原语和操作规则,采用动态建模的方法实现了工作流模型的动态演变.  相似文献   

6.
目前大多数工作流系统都不能支持动态可变的柔性特征,而支持动态可变的柔性工作流系统是人们在实际应用中对工作流系统提出的新要求,也是企业为了满足业务流程变更的需要.提高工作流系统的柔性需要从工作流的建模、系统设计等各方面去努力.在协同信牌驱动工作流模式模型的基础上引进了适合该模式的柔性建模的元模型,并且提出了限制该模型的一些规则来讨论基于该模型的柔性建模工作流系统的实现.  相似文献   

7.
在面向服务体系结构和Web服务技术快速发展的条件下,对封装成服务的业务过程集成和协作的支持成为工作流描述语言的发展趋势。通过对流程协作的层次模型和场景模型的分析,提出了一种基于WfMC工作流元模型的扩展元模型,并根据该元模型对XPDL进行了相关元素扩展,得到一种支持流程集成和协作的工作流语言PS-XPDL。该语言对流程服务的协作关系及数据同步具有完备、准确的表达,同时其基于执行支持层标准协议的扩展也使得流程服务的集成及协作易于实现。  相似文献   

8.
工作流技术是实现办公自动化系统的一个有力的软件工具,在它的设计和实现过程中,需要解决一系列的问题,如:工作流的定义、工作流关系、工作流的流转等等。论文结合实际给出了公文流转系统中公文流的定义,详细分析了公文流节点关系,使用关系数据库模型来描述公文流转,并基于该模型给出公文流转策略和数据库实现。该方法和模型能较好地适应办公自动化系统,具有通用性。  相似文献   

9.
本文提出了一个基于工作流技术的协同处理模型。用户可以定制工作流,并将基于角色和任务的访问控制运用于模型中,实现安全访问控制的工作流建模。利用该模型,研发了信访业务协同处理系统,介绍了系统的动态工作流管理技术、基于角色和任务的工作流访问控制与协调处理方法。  相似文献   

10.
基于本体的迁移工作流服务模型研究   总被引:1,自引:0,他引:1  
宋淼  曾广周  范志强 《计算机应用》2006,26(7):1517-1519
针对迁移工作流服务语义共享的特点,基于本体论,提出一种迁移工作流服务模型。该模型通过工作流元本体为迁移实例和各站点提供统一的工作流服务语义。在此基础上,通过服务本体描述和组织迁移工作流服务,实现服务发现。该模型较好地实现了迁移实例与各站点间的语义共享。  相似文献   

11.
陈翔  刘军丽 《计算机工程》2007,33(13):65-67
针对工作流管理系统的实现复杂性及模型可靠性的验证问题,提出了一种结合工作流网和ECA规则来创建工作流管理系统的方法。这种基于ECA规则的工作流描述和执行机制较好地实现了工作流网模型的语义描述和控制的统一。通过建立基于ECA规则的工作流描述表,将ECA 规则引入到工作流路由机制中,灵活地控制了工作流的流程。通过事件触发和消息处理机制,工作流描述表处理可以被实际系统加以执行和控制。  相似文献   

12.
Workflow mining: discovering process models from event logs   总被引:17,自引:0,他引:17  
Contemporary workflow management systems are driven by explicit process models, i.e., a completely specified workflow design is required in order to enact a given workflow process. Creating a workflow design is a complicated time-consuming process and, typically, there are discrepancies between the actual workflow processes and the processes as perceived by the management. Therefore, we have developed techniques for discovering workflow models. The starting point for such techniques is a so-called "workflow log" containing information about the workflow process as it is actually being executed. We present a new algorithm to extract a process model from such a log and represent it in terms of a Petri net. However, we also demonstrate that it is not possible to discover arbitrary workflow processes. We explore a class of workflow processes that can be discovered. We show that the /spl alpha/-algorithm can successfully mine any workflow represented by a so-called SWF-net.  相似文献   

13.
一个基于软件Agent的工艺工作流系统   总被引:7,自引:1,他引:6  
先进制造模式对工艺设计提出了过程管理的要求,基于工作流技术和软件Agent技术,设计了一个能有效实现过程管理的计算机辅助工艺设计系统,通过对工艺流程的分析,建立了形式化的工艺工作流模型,在此基础上,定义了包括过程、意向、技能、熟人等模型的实现工作流运行的软件Aent模型,构造了可嵌套的Agent联邦结构,增强了系统的灵活性,上述关键技术在自主开发的商品化软件GS-CAPP中得以实现。  相似文献   

14.
该文提出了一个基于CORBA的完全分布式的工作流管理系统框架,在系统进程执行的过程中,进程的定义可以进行动态修改,解决了Client/Server模式中服务器将成为应用处理过程中瓶颈的问题、服务器一旦出现差错则导致整个系统瘫痪的问题以及工作流一经定义就无法修改的弊端,从而克服了基于Client/Server模式的工作流管理系统的一个固有缺陷,使工作流管理系统向大规模、灵活的方向发展。  相似文献   

15.
一种模型驱动的工作流过程定义途径   总被引:2,自引:0,他引:2  
传统的工作流管理系统在互操作性,可复用性,可移植性和开发效率等方面遇到了挑战,MDA是解决上述挑战和问题的一种途径。在模型驱动的工作流管理系统中,工作流模型处于核心地位,本文首先给出了扩展的工作流元模型和基于Petri网的形式化工作流模型过程网。其次,运用模型驱动的途径,依据给出的工作流模型,本文提出了一种模型驱动的,用于快速构造工作流管理系统的框架。针对工作流过程模型,着重讨论了从基于EPC的过程CIM到基于过程网的过程PIM的转换(转换过程和转换规则),并以扩展的Petri网标注语言E-PNML规约了过程PIM。  相似文献   

16.
支持工作流动态变化的过程元模型   总被引:43,自引:0,他引:43       下载免费PDF全文
支持动态可变并具备灵活性是人们在实际应用中对工作流管理系统提出的新要求,已有的相关研究工作都集中在对工作流中发生变化的某个具体问题上.提出了支持动态特性的工作流过程元模型,可以为动态过程模型的设计提供指导.从时间和工作流组成的过程级别两个角度分析了其动态特性的表现,扩展了工作流管理联盟的工作流元模型.扩展后的过程元模型在工作流的建立阶段力求将动态特性进行描述和定义,在工作流执行阶段可以根据已定义的动态属性,处理过程的变化情况.基于该元模型,工作流管理系统既具有灵活性,又有利于变化控制操作.  相似文献   

17.
Inheritance of workflows: an approach to tackling problems related to change   总被引:30,自引:0,他引:30  
Inheritance is one of the key issues of object-orientation. The inheritance mechanism allows for the definition of a subclass which inherits the features of a specific superclass. When adapting a workflow process definition to specific needs (ad-hoc change) or changing the structure of the workflow process as a result of reengineering efforts (evolutionary change), inheritance concepts are useful to check whether the new workflow process inherits some desirable properties of the old workflow process. Today's workflow management systems have problems dealing with both ad-hoc changes and evolutionary changes. As a result, a workflow management system is not used to support dynamically changing workflow processes or the workflow processes are supported in a rigid manner, i.e., changes are not allowed or handled outside of the workflow management system. In this paper, we propose inheritance-preserving transformation rules for workflow processes and show that these rules can be used to avoid problems such as the “dynamic-change bug.” The dynamic-change bug refers to errors introduced by migrating a case (i.e., a process instance) from an old process definition to a new one. A transfer from an old process to a new process can lead to duplication of work, skipping of tasks, deadlocks, and livelocks. Restricting change to the inheritance-preserving transformation rules guarantees transfers without any of these problems. Moreover, the transformation rules can also be used to extract aggregate management information in case more than one version of a workflow process cannot be avoided.  相似文献   

18.
嵌入工作流的ERP系统的设计与实现   总被引:1,自引:0,他引:1  
传统ERP系统在业务流程管理方面存在不足,通过引入工作流管理能够弥补其不足.通过比较自治工作流管理系统与嵌入式工作流管理系统,提出在ERP系统中采用嵌入式工作流管理的方法.从工作流建模和过程控制方面,介绍了基于UML活动图模型的嵌入式工作流管理模块的设计和实现方法.给出了支持工作流的ERP系统的实施方法.通过嵌入工作流管理到传统ERP系统中,提高了系统对企业业务的适应能力,也提高了软件重用和开发效率.  相似文献   

19.
Adaptability has become one of the major research topics in the area of workflow management. Today's workflow management systems have problems dealing with both ad-hoc changes and evolutionary changes. As a result, the workflow management system is not used to support dynamically changing workflow processes or the workflow process is supported in a rigid manner, i.e., changes are not allowed or handled outside of the workflow management system. In this paper, we focus on a notorious problem caused by workflow change: the dynamic change bug (Ellis et al.; Proceedings of the Conference on Organizational Computing Systems, Milpitas, California, ACM SIGOIS, ACM Press, New York, 1995, pp. 10–21). The dynamic change bug refers to errors introduced by migrating a case (i.e., a process instance) from the old process definition to the new one. A transfer from the old process to the new process can lead to duplication of work, skipping of tasks, deadlocks, and livelocks. This paper describes an approach for calculating a safe change region. If a case is in such a change region, the transfer is postponed.  相似文献   

20.
分析办公自动化(OA)系统中的流程模型,参考工作流管理联盟的基于XML的过程定义语言,提出OA系统的基本流程元模型设计,其中包括OA系统的流程模型、元模型规范、处理规范等,解决了OA系统中流程的标准化处理问题,适用于建立具有行业范围的OA系统流程及处理规范,有利于促进OA系统的标准化建设。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号